国产三级在线视频观看_亚洲图片一区_欧美色图亚洲天堂_国产精品亚洲综合

News

Coal industry: investment opportunities brought by supply-side reform
RELEASE TIME: 2019-06-27

The coal industry has experienced three historical cycles. In 2016, the supply-side reform brought cycle reversal. After a 10-year upward cycle (2002-2012) and a three-year downward cycle (2013-2015), the nationwide supply-side reform in 2016 has brought new vitality to the coal industry. The elimination of idle capacity and reduction of coal supply have led to a significant increase in coal prices since q4 2016.

The supply-side reform in 2016 produced better results than expected, and coal prices rebounded rapidly. On the supply side, coal supply side reform in 2016 removed 290 million tons of production capacity, with an annual target of 250 million tons, 16% of which exceeded the target. On the demand side, coal's main downstream power and steel industry demand growth is good. Coal prices have risen significantly since mid-2016, driven by the reversal of supply and demand. Qinhuangdao port 5500 ka thermal coal market price rose from 370 yuan/ton at the beginning of 2016 to the highest 650 yuan/ton.

In 2017, the reform of the coal supply side continued to deepen, and the replacement of new production capacity entered the fast lane. In 2017, the total target for coal supply side reform was to cut coal production capacity by 150 million tons. In the first half of this year, China cut coal production capacity by 111 million tons, 74% of the annual target. The priorities for the next 17 years will be to promote mergers and acquisitions, reduce the number of replacement, and implement effective financial policies. On the whole, due to the continuous high coal price and breaking through the green price range, coal capacity replacement has entered the fast lane since 2017.

Coal demand is expected to maintain a certain growth in the future. Based on the analysis of coal's main downstream industries, it is estimated that the coal consumption of thermal power generation in 2017-2020 will be 1.94 billion tons, 1.98 billion tons, 2.05 billion tons and 2.12 billion tons respectively. Coal consumption in the steel industry was 670 million tons, 680 million tons, 620 million tons, 610 million tons and 610 million tons respectively. Coal consumption in the building materials industry was 320 million tons, 310 million tons, 300 million tons and 300 million tons, respectively. Coal consumption in the chemical industry was 173 million tons, 178 million tons, 182 million tons and 186 million tons. Overall, coal consumption is expected to total 4.03 billion tons, 4.03 billion tons, 4.11 billion tons and 4.2 billion tons in 2017-2020.

It is expected that the coal market will maintain a high boom in 17-18, and supply and demand will gradually return to balance in 19-20. Taking into account the impact of overcapacity reduction and new capacity release, we expect China's coal output to be 3.49 billion tons, 3.60 billion tons, 3.71 billion tons and 3.82 billion tons from 2017 to 2020. Combined with the results of demand-side forecast, we believe that the coal industry will still be in short supply in 2017 and 2018, and with the gradual release of domestic coal production capacity, the relationship between coal supply and demand will gradually return to balance in 2019-2020.


PREV:FreeMarker template error (DEBUG mode; use RETHROW in production!): The following has evaluated to null or missing: ==> f.mainTitle [in template "127/138/template/default/common/detail_pagination.html" at line 6, column 79] ---- Tip: It's the step after the last dot that caused this error, not those before it. ---- Tip: If the failing expression is known to legally refer to something that's sometimes null or missing, either specify a default value like myOptionalVar!myDefault, or use when-missing. (These only cover the last step of the expression; to cover the whole expression, use parenthesis: (myOptionalVar.foo)!myDefault, (myOptionalVar.foo)?? ---- ---- FTL stack trace ("~" means nesting-related): - Failed at: FreeMarker template error (DEBUG mode; use RETHROW in production!): The following has evaluated to null or missing: ==> f [in template "127/138/html/details/2489.html" at line 156, column 24] ---- Tip: If the failing expression is known to legally refer to something that's sometimes null or missing, either specify a default value like myOptionalVar!myDefault, or use <#if myOptionalVar??>when-present<#else>when-missing. (These only cover the last step of the expression; to cover the whole expression, use parenthesis: (myOptionalVar.foo)!myDefault, (myOptionalVar.foo)?? ---- ---- FTL stack trace ("~" means nesting-related): - Failed at: ${f.mainTitle} [in template "127/138/html/details/2489.html" at line 156, column 22] ---- Java stack trace (for programmers): ---- freemarker.core.InvalidReferenceException: [... Exception message was already printed; see it above ...] at freemarker.core.InvalidReferenceException.getInstance(InvalidReferenceException.java:134) at freemarker.core.UnexpectedTypeException.newDesciptionBuilder(UnexpectedTypeException.java:85) at freemarker.core.UnexpectedTypeException.(UnexpectedTypeException.java:48) at freemarker.core.NonHashException.(NonHashException.java:49) at freemarker.core.Dot._eval(Dot.java:48) at freemarker.core.Expression.eval(Expression.java:83) at freemarker.core.DollarVariable.calculateInterpolatedStringOrMarkup(DollarVariable.java:96) at freemarker.core.DollarVariable.accept(DollarVariable.java:59) at freemarker.core.Environment.visit(Environment.java:325) at freemarker.core.Environment.visit(Environment.java:331) at freemarker.core.Environment.process(Environment.java:304) at freemarker.template.Template.process(Template.java:382) at org.springframework.web.servlet.view.freemarker.FreeMarkerView.processTemplate(FreeMarkerView.java:396) at org.springframework.web.servlet.view.freemarker.FreeMarkerView.doRender(FreeMarkerView.java:309) at org.springframework.web.servlet.view.freemarker.FreeMarkerView.renderMergedTemplateModel(FreeMarkerView.java:257) at org.springframework.web.servlet.view.AbstractTemplateView.renderMergedOutputModel(AbstractTemplateView.java:165) at org.springframework.web.servlet.view.AbstractView.render(AbstractView.java:314) at org.springframework.web.servlet.DispatcherServlet.render(DispatcherServlet.java:1325) at org.springframework.web.servlet.DispatcherServlet.processDispatchResult(DispatcherServlet.java:1069) at org.springframework.web.servlet.DispatcherServlet.doDispatch(DispatcherServlet.java:1008) at org.springframework.web.servlet.DispatcherServlet.doService(DispatcherServlet.java:925) at org.springframework.web.servlet.FrameworkServlet.processRequest(FrameworkServlet.java:978) at org.springframework.web.servlet.FrameworkServlet.doGet(FrameworkServlet.java:870) at javax.servlet.http.HttpServlet.service(HttpServlet.java:635) at org.springframework.web.servlet.FrameworkServlet.service(FrameworkServlet.java:855) at javax.servlet.http.HttpServlet.service(HttpServlet.java:742) at org.apache.catalina.core.ApplicationFilterChain.internalDoFilter(ApplicationFilterChain.java:231) at org.apache.catalina.core.ApplicationFilterChain.doFilter(ApplicationFilterChain.java:166) at org.apache.tomcat.websocket.server.WsFilter.doFilter(WsFilter.java:52) at org.apache.catalina.core.ApplicationFilterChain.internalDoFilter(ApplicationFilterChain.java:193) at org.apache.catalina.core.ApplicationFilterChain.doFilter(ApplicationFilterChain.java:166) at org.springframework.web.filter.CorsFilter.doFilterInternal(CorsFilter.java:96) at org.springframework.web.filter.OncePerRequestFilter.doFilter(OncePerRequestFilter.java:107) at org.apache.catalina.core.ApplicationFilterChain.internalDoFilter(ApplicationFilterChain.java:193) at org.apache.catalina.core.ApplicationFilterChain.doFilter(ApplicationFilterChain.java:166) at com.alibaba.druid.support.http.WebStatFilter.doFilter(WebStatFilter.java:123) at org.apache.catalina.core.ApplicationFilterChain.internalDoFilter(ApplicationFilterChain.java:193) at org.apache.catalina.core.ApplicationFilterChain.doFilter(ApplicationFilterChain.java:166) at com.nx.plugin.basic.api.framework.filter.XssFilter.doFilter(XssFilter.java:39) at org.apache.catalina.core.ApplicationFilterChain.internalDoFilter(ApplicationFilterChain.java:193) at org.apache.catalina.core.ApplicationFilterChain.doFilter(ApplicationFilterChain.java:166) at org.springframework.web.filter.RequestContextFilter.doFilterInternal(RequestContextFilter.java:99) at org.springframework.web.filter.OncePerRequestFilter.doFilter(OncePerRequestFilter.java:107) at org.apache.catalina.core.ApplicationFilterChain.internalDoFilter(ApplicationFilterChain.java:193) at org.apache.catalina.core.ApplicationFilterChain.doFilter(ApplicationFilterChain.java:166) at org.springframework.web.filter.HttpPutFormContentFilter.doFilterInternal(HttpPutFormContentFilter.java:109) at org.springframework.web.filter.OncePerRequestFilter.doFilter(OncePerRequestFilter.java:107) at org.apache.catalina.core.ApplicationFilterChain.internalDoFilter(ApplicationFilterChain.java:193) at org.apache.catalina.core.ApplicationFilterChain.doFilter(ApplicationFilterChain.java:166) at org.springframework.web.filter.HiddenHttpMethodFilter.doFilterInternal(HiddenHttpMethodFilter.java:81) at org.springframework.web.filter.OncePerRequestFilter.doFilter(OncePerRequestFilter.java:107) at org.apache.catalina.core.ApplicationFilterChain.internalDoFilter(ApplicationFilterChain.java:193) at org.apache.catalina.core.ApplicationFilterChain.doFilter(ApplicationFilterChain.java:166) at org.springframework.session.web.http.SessionRepositoryFilter.doFilterInternal(SessionRepositoryFilter.java:146) at org.springframework.session.web.http.OncePerRequestFilter.doFilter(OncePerRequestFilter.java:81) at org.apache.catalina.core.ApplicationFilterChain.internalDoFilter(ApplicationFilterChain.java:193) at org.apache.catalina.core.ApplicationFilterChain.doFilter(ApplicationFilterChain.java:166) at org.springframework.web.filter.CharacterEncodingFilter.doFilterInternal(CharacterEncodingFilter.java:200) at org.springframework.web.filter.OncePerRequestFilter.doFilter(OncePerRequestFilter.java:107) at org.apache.catalina.core.ApplicationFilterChain.internalDoFilter(ApplicationFilterChain.java:193) at org.apache.catalina.core.ApplicationFilterChain.doFilter(ApplicationFilterChain.java:166) at org.apache.catalina.core.StandardWrapperValve.invoke(StandardWrapperValve.java:199) at org.apache.catalina.core.StandardContextValve.invoke(StandardContextValve.java:96) at org.apache.catalina.authenticator.AuthenticatorBase.invoke(AuthenticatorBase.java:496) at org.apache.catalina.core.StandardHostValve.invoke(StandardHostValve.java:140) at org.apache.catalina.valves.ErrorReportValve.invoke(ErrorReportValve.java:81) at org.apache.catalina.core.StandardEngineValve.invoke(StandardEngineValve.java:87) at org.apache.catalina.valves.RemoteIpValve.invoke(RemoteIpValve.java:677) at org.apache.catalina.connector.CoyoteAdapter.service(CoyoteAdapter.java:342) at org.apache.coyote.http11.Http11Processor.service(Http11Processor.java:803) at org.apache.coyote.AbstractProcessorLight.process(AbstractProcessorLight.java:66) at org.apache.coyote.AbstractProtocol$ConnectionHandler.process(AbstractProtocol.java:790) at org.apache.tomcat.util.net.NioEndpoint$SocketProcessor.doRun(NioEndpoint.java:1459) at org.apache.tomcat.util.net.SocketProcessorBase.run(SocketProcessorBase.java:49) at java.util.concurrent.ThreadPoolExecutor.runWorker(ThreadPoolExecutor.java:1149) at java.util.concurrent.ThreadPoolExecutor$Worker.run(ThreadPoolExecutor.java:624) at org.apache.tomcat.util.threads.TaskThread$WrappingRunnable.run(TaskThread.java:61) at java.lang.Thread.run(Thread.java:748) 系統提示
系統提示
系統提示
国产三级在线视频观看_亚洲图片一区_欧美色图亚洲天堂_国产精品亚洲综合
国产酒店精品激情| 亚洲午夜激情网页| 国产嫩草一区二区三区在线观看| 激情一区二区| 久热精品视频在线免费观看| 国产精品久久一区二区三区| 亚洲性色视频| 欧美精品激情在线观看| 国内外成人在线| 久久婷婷影院| 国产日韩欧美一区| 久久影视精品| 国语自产精品视频在线看一大j8| 久久最新视频| 狠狠久久婷婷| 欧美国产三级| 亚洲少妇一区| 欧美精品国产一区二区| 在线观看福利一区| 欧美大片免费观看| **网站欧美大片在线观看| 欧美国产三区| 亚洲一级电影| 国产精品v一区二区三区| 亚洲欧美成人一区二区在线电影 | 欧美日本一道本| 中文精品视频| 欧美日本亚洲| 午夜在线精品| 国产精品日韩一区二区三区| 久久激情综合网| 国产午夜一区二区三区| 美女精品在线| 在线国产欧美| 欧美视频在线一区| 久久精品在线免费观看| 国产综合在线看| 久久精品国产成人| 国产综合色产在线精品| 欧美综合77777色婷婷| 国产精品久久久久久久久久久久久| 亚洲男人天堂2024| 国产精品久久毛片a| 久久免费国产精品1| 激情成人综合| 欧美日韩一级大片网址| 欧美一区精品| 国产一区二区日韩精品| 欧美激情女人20p| 亚洲欧美日韩国产综合精品二区| 国产精品久久久999| 久久综合中文| 亚洲一区二区三区四区在线观看 | 黄色亚洲大片免费在线观看| 欧美精品v日韩精品v国产精品| 亚洲一区二区三区久久| 国产精品入口福利| 免费不卡在线观看av| 亚洲性感美女99在线| 国产精品美女www爽爽爽| 久久在线播放| 亚洲一区二区三区在线播放| 国产精品美女久久久久久免费 | 国产精品午夜av在线| 免费久久99精品国产自在现线| 亚洲一区二区久久| 国产日韩欧美高清免费| 欧美日韩色一区| 久久综合狠狠综合久久综合88 | 黄色一区二区在线观看| 欧美性久久久| 免费亚洲一区| 久久国内精品视频| 国产精品99久久不卡二区| 国产免费成人av| 欧美日韩精品一二三区| 久久午夜电影网| 亚洲欧美视频在线| 尤妮丝一区二区裸体视频| 国产精品欧美日韩| 欧美日韩三区| 欧美国产视频日韩| 久久综合网络一区二区| 午夜在线成人av| 亚洲一区二区高清| 狠狠久久综合婷婷不卡| 国产伦一区二区三区色一情| 欧美日韩国产一级片| 麻豆国产精品777777在线| 欧美一进一出视频| 亚洲专区国产精品| 中文精品视频| 精品va天堂亚洲国产| 国产一区二区日韩| 国产日韩精品久久| 国产精品麻豆成人av电影艾秋| 欧美日韩和欧美的一区二区| 免费久久精品视频| 免费成人毛片| 久久久久久久成人| 久久精品99无色码中文字幕 | 欧美日韩亚洲一区二区三区在线观看 | 狠狠干综合网| 国产一区欧美| 国产一区二区三区视频在线观看| 国产精品卡一卡二卡三| 国产精品久在线观看| 欧美小视频在线观看| 欧美性理论片在线观看片免费| 欧美精品尤物在线| 欧美女主播在线| 欧美日韩福利视频| 欧美全黄视频| 欧美日韩1区| 欧美日韩亚洲综合| 欧美日韩视频| 欧美亚洲不卡| 国产精品久久久久9999高清| 国产精品免费视频观看| 国产精品美女www爽爽爽视频| 国产精品免费区二区三区观看| 国产精品免费在线| 国产精品永久免费视频| 欧美一区网站| 亚洲视频在线播放| 亚洲永久免费av| 午夜在线成人av| 久久国产毛片| 免费高清在线一区| 欧美精品一区二区三区在线播放| 欧美日韩色婷婷| 国产精品人人爽人人做我的可爱 | 亚洲免费一在线| 亚洲欧美日韩一区二区在线| 香蕉久久久久久久av网站 | 国产伦精品一区二区三区| 国产日韩欧美一区二区三区在线观看 | 免播放器亚洲| 欧美日韩dvd在线观看| 欧美日韩国产综合视频在线观看 | 欧美系列一区| 国产视频在线一区二区| 在线成人性视频| 午夜精品www| 久久亚洲一区二区三区四区| 久久亚洲影院| 欧美日韩国产首页在线观看| 国产精品久久久久久久久久久久| 国产亚洲免费的视频看| 亚洲一区二区欧美日韩| 久久av老司机精品网站导航| 久久综合伊人| 欧美日韩一区二区视频在线观看| 国产精品一区一区三区| 欧美永久精品| 国产一区二区三区四区五区美女| 激情综合视频| 欧美一区二区视频观看视频| 裸体素人女欧美日韩| 欧美日韩在线视频首页| 国产欧美日本| 在线视频观看日韩| 久久精品国产久精国产一老狼| 欧美国产乱视频| 国产免费一区二区三区香蕉精| 正在播放亚洲| 久久久国产亚洲精品| 欧美区国产区| 黑人巨大精品欧美黑白配亚洲| 亚洲午夜免费视频| 久久露脸国产精品| 国产精品扒开腿爽爽爽视频| 国内精品久久久久久久影视麻豆 | 欧美成人免费视频| 国产精品国色综合久久| 精品999久久久| 久久久九九九九| 欧美日韩久久| 国产一区二区久久精品| 欧美在线播放一区二区| 欧美乱妇高清无乱码| 国产一区二区三区四区三区四| 亚洲欧洲99久久| 欧美国产日韩在线观看| 国产日韩欧美精品综合| 新狼窝色av性久久久久久| 欧美黄色aa电影| 国产一区二区精品在线观看| 欧美一区二区视频在线| 欧美日韩国产91| 黑人操亚洲美女惩罚| 久久欧美肥婆一二区| 国产精品一二三四| 欧美亚洲免费高清在线观看| 欧美日本一区二区视频在线观看| 狠狠色狠狠色综合人人| 久久亚洲影音av资源网| 国产精品亚洲激情| 欧美一区二区日韩一区二区| 欧美日韩精品综合在线|